I love the smell of burning 2-stroke in the morning....

BTW: what's a Jet 200? We, in UK and within the scope of the 'sportier' Lambrettas, had the SX200, TV200 & GP200 (rectangular headlamp). Different markets, different (2)strokes! Plenty of tuning kits from companies like Ancillotti; 225cc barrel/piston kits & bigger carbs -- up to 35hp! Frighteningly capable of 100mph on those unstable little wheels....
